Throughout history, there have been several notable individuals who have carried the surname Keckley. One of the most famous is Elizabeth Keckley, a former slave who became a successful seamstress and businesswoman in the 19th century. Keckley is best known for her association with Mary Todd Lincoln, the wife of President Abraham Lincoln, for whom she worked as a personal dressmaker.
Elizabeth Keckley's life and achievements are chronicled in her autobiography, "Behind the Scenes: Thirty Years a Slave and Four Years in the White House." Her story is one of resilience, determination, and success in the face of adversity, making her a remarkable figure in American history.
